what molarity is glacial acetic acid_what molarity is glacial acetic acid3. Uses The applications of glacial acetic acid differ significantly from its diluted counterpart. Glacial acetic acid is often used in industrial settings for manufacturing synthetic fibers, plastics, and even pharmaceuticals. It serves as a key ingredient in the production of acetate esters, which have applications ranging from solvents to food flavorings. In contrast, diluted acetic acid is primarily used in culinary settings, household cleaning products, and as a preservative.

what molarity is glacial acetic acid_what molarity is glacial acetic acidGlacial acetic acid, also known as ethanoic acid, is a colorless liquid organic compound with a pungent smell. It is a vital chemical in various industrial applications, as well as in laboratory and household uses. With a chemical formula of CH₃COOH, glacial acetic acid is the pure form of acetic acid, containing at least 99% of the compound. Its properties and versatility contribute to its widespread use across different sectors.

what molarity is glacial acetic acid_what molarity is glacial acetic acidGlacial acetic acid is essentially acetic acid that contains minimal water content, typically about 99% purity. Its molecular formula is C2H4O2, and it is known for its high acidity, with a pKa of approximately 4.76. This makes it a weak acid, but one that is strong enough to react with various substances. The compound's freezing point is 16.6°C, below which it solidifies into a white, crystalline substance. Its high density and viscosity differentiate it from diluted forms of acetic acid, lending unique properties to its applications.

what molarity is glacial acetic acid_what molarity is glacial acetic acidThe primary methods for producing glacial acetic acid include carbonylation of methanol, which typically leads to high yields, and the fermentation of biomass. The carbonylation process is prevalent in large-scale industrial settings due to its efficiency and cost-effectiveness. As concerns regarding environmental sustainability rise, there has been an increasing interest in bio-based production methods that utilize renewable resources. These emerging technologies not only contribute to reducing the carbon footprint but also meet the growing demand for eco-friendly products.

On the other hand, glacial acetic acid is a term used to describe acetic acid that is concentrated to a point where it can solidify at low temperatures, specifically below 16.6 °C. At this point, glacial acetic acid appears as a solid, ice-like substance, hence the name “glacial.” In practical terms, glacial acetic acid typically contains about 99% acetic acid, with trace amounts of water or other impurities.
The environmental hazards of glacial acetic acid should not be overlooked. When released into the environment, it can have detrimental effects on aquatic life and ecosystems. Glacial acetic acid is soluble in water and can rapidly contaminate water sources, affecting flora and fauna. In great quantities, it can lead to decreased pH levels in water bodies, which can be harmful to aquatic organisms that are sensitive to changes in their environment. Therefore, it is important for industries that utilize glacial acetic acid to implement containment measures and spill response plans to mitigate environmental risks.

The cost of glacial acetic acid is influenced heavily by the production process and the cost of raw materials. The most common method of production is through the carbonylation of methanol, which requires significant capital investment in infrastructure and technology. Methanol, the primary raw material, is derived from natural gas or biomass, making fluctuations in natural gas prices a key factor in determining the overall cost of glacial acetic acid. When natural gas prices rise, the cost of methanol and subsequently acetic acid also tends to increase, impacting the entire supply chain.
